TURN-208: Gatevale turnstile counters at the Merrow Field pilot double-count when a rotation reverses mid-cycle. Attendance totals drift roughly 2% high per event. The debounce window fix is implemented, reviewed by Ilsa, and soak-tested across two simulated match days without drift. Ready for your cut; the candidate build is identified below.

trace token, tagag-tafog: htk6_5ed18c

Subject: Pagination cut-over complete — Orvex Public API

Hello plugin authors,

The cut-over from offset-based to cursor-based pagination finished last night without data loss. Offset parameters now return a deprecation warning and will be rejected after the grace period. Please verify your plugins handle the new cursor tokens and page-size limits. The active pagination configuration is listed below for your reference.

deployment values, yadup-kadug:
[sorys]
port = 5672
team = noveth
host = sorys.orvexcorp.example
region = south-4
access_code = ac_deddc1
timeout_ms = 1500

## Break-Glass Access: Relevance Tuning Console

If the Quartzline ranking dashboard locks out all maintainers, break-glass access restores edit rights to the boost-weight config. Use only when synonym or recency tuning is blocking a release. Actions are audited by the Perlin team. To unlock the emergency editor, enter the recovery passphrase below.

strongbox words: wenix-ulador